Three Drives

Where did you discover trance?

When I worked as a DJ at the Rotterdam based radio station "Stadsradio Rotterdam" having my own radio show called "Turbulence" in 1995. I programmed early trance tunes on the show, and as a producer back then I released a bunch of records combining trance melodies with club beats, which laid the foundation for the (at that time) mighty popular "clubtrance" style. The best example have to be our highly successful release "Department 1 – Together".

Who has been your biggest influence?

As I'm from the "old school days" and was influenced by the eighties in particular, I'd have to say Jean Michel Jarre, Ben Liebrand and Peter Slaghuis (Hithouse).

What moment would you live again if you could?

I guess the moment we heard that "Greece 2000" hit number 12 in the UK Singles Charts, and the madhouse and media circus that followed soon after that! We heard the news of our UK entry when we were having dinner with our record company in a restaurant in Cannes, when we were there for the Midem conference. We got very drunk that night, haha!

Where in the world is trance-central?

Considering the fact that our little country is the world's biggest supplier of trance talent and we regularly provide the number 1 DJ in the DJ Mag Top 100: The Netherlands!
